| Found this at BevMo for $8. R. Parker apparently gave it an 86. I figured I'd try it though I knew nothing about the wine. Turns out that Primitivo is a Zinfandel from the boot of Italy. No wonder I liked it. I went back and bought half a case. I rate it up there with some of the better wines I've had recently. If you like Zins, my bet is you'd like this wine. I love it. My favorite QPR.
A-Manu 1999 Primivito
Color: Deep purple - red, almost opaque Cost: $8
Smell: Black fruit, black currant, black cherry, vanilla, no off odors
Taste: Great acid balance, rich, mildly tannnic, good balance, not bone dry, good with food
Rating: 90 | | |
